Vulnerability

The vulnerability is a Local File Inclusion (LFI) flaw resulting from the improper sanitization of user-supplied input used in PHP include or require statements. An unauthenticated attacker can manipulate input parameters, typically in a URL, to include directory traversal sequences (e.g., ../). This tricks the application into including and potentially executing or displaying the contents of arbitrary files from the local filesystem, limited only by the web server's file system permissions.

Business impact

This is a High severity vulnerability with a CVSS score of 8.1. Exploitation could have severe consequences for the business, including a major data breach through the theft of sensitive information like database credentials, API keys, or customer data stored on the server. An attacker could leverage this access to achieve remote code execution by tricking the application into including a previously uploaded file or by poisoning log files with malicious PHP code. This could lead to a complete compromise of the server, reputational damage, financial loss, and regulatory penalties.

Remediation

Immediate Action: Apply vendor-supplied security updates immediately to all affected systems. Prioritize patching on internet-facing systems to reduce the attack surface. After patching, review web server access logs for any signs of compromise that may have occurred before the update was applied.

Proactive Monitoring: Monitor web server access logs for suspicious requests containing directory traversal patterns (../, %2e%2e%2f), absolute file paths (/etc/passwd), or PHP filter wrappers (php://filter). Implement file integrity monitoring (FIM) to detect unauthorized changes to application files. Monitor for unusual outbound network connections from the web server, which could indicate a successful compromise.

Compensating Controls: If immediate patching is not feasible, implement a Web Application Firewall (WAF) with rulesets designed to detect and block LFI and directory traversal attacks. Harden the PHP configuration by ensuring a restrictive open_basedir is set, which limits the files that PHP can access on the filesystem. Ensure the web server process runs with the lowest possible user privileges to limit the impact of a potential breach.
